Frequently Asked Questions about Berkeley
How much are Studio apartments in Berkeley?
There are currently 1,739 Studio Apartments in Berkeley with rent ranges from $800 to $5,558 with an average price of $2,185.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Berkeley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Berkeley ranges from $765 to $9,925 with an average monthly rent of $2,767.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Berkeley c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Berkeley range from $472 to $15,481.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,286.
How expensive are Berkeley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 577 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Berkeley on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$612 to $9,021 - averaging $3,519 for the location.
